Calculate Log Base 51 of 15

To solve the equation log 51 (15)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 15, a = 51:
    log 51 (15) = log(15) / log(51)
  3. Evaluate the term:
    log(15) / log(51)
    = 1.39794000867204 / 1.92427928606188
    = 0.68875134710026
    = Logarithm of 15 with base 51
